Chapter 2. Apex Limits

When you stay at a friend's house, you behave a little differently than when you're at home. You wipe your shoes before you enter, you don't put your feet on the coffee table, and you even use a coaster for your drink. The same holds true for the Salesforce1 Platform. While you might be paying rent, your code isn't running on your own server, so you have to follow the house rules. In Apex, these rules are referred to as the governor limits and they dictate what your code can and can't do when executed.

It doesn't make sense to write a whole chapter on Apex governor limits. Salesforce releases three major upgrades a year. These upgrades typically include classes and methods that correspond to the various new features available in the Salesforce GUI. Sometimes though, they also include a reduction in the Apex governor limits. In fact, this happens often enough that documenting the limits today would most likely render this chapter obsolete within a year from when we wrote it. This puts us in a tricky situation. If we don't write about the limits, we're ignoring a huge aspect of Apex, but if we do write about them, we're giving this book a short shelf life. Instead, we compromised and decided to discuss the concepts of the limits, how they affect us, and how we get around them. We have not discussed the specific quantities except for the ones used in examples. Only time will tell how we have fared.
